The present invention relates to a concrete structure, which is a kind of structure made of a hydration reactant, because when vibration is applied by external factors, the speed transmitted from the inside of the material is different depending on the strength and elastic modulus, and the response characteristics according to the excitation frequency are different. It is possible to reliably monitor the strength of the structure by measuring the strength of the structure and the ground. An object thereof is to provide a strength signal measurement method and a strength signal measurement device for strength monitoring. According to the present invention, an AC electric signal generating step of generating an AC electric signal of a specific waveform having a frequency of a predetermined frequency band; An AC electric signal applying step of applying the generated AC electric signal to the piezoelectric element for a predetermined period of time; A frequency-impedance detection step of detecting a change in the resonance frequency and impedance of the piezoelectric element according to the frequency of the AC electrical signal applied in the AC electrical signal applying step; And a pressure change measuring step of measuring a change in a physical pressure applied to the piezoelectric element as an intensity signal based on a change in the detected resonance frequency and impedance of the piezoelectric element. A method of measuring intensity signals for monitoring is provided.
